Kraken powers innovative global developments in energy. We’re a technology company focused on creating a smart, sustainable energy system. From optimizing renewable generation, creating a more intelligent grid, and enabling utilities to provide excellent customer experiences, our operating system for energy transforms the industry worldwide for the benefit of all.

We are looking for a brilliant Client Delivery Lead to build industry‑leading product experiences for our clients. If you love making things better for customers, building great products, working with technology, and bringing people together to find solutions, then you’ve come to the right place.

We are a flat and agile organisation. The Client Delivery Lead will work as an individual contributor, help build our capability across Kraken and other third parties, and solve complex problems with great products. They manage the product roadmap, collaborate with technology and operational teams, and bring people and processes together to innovate improvements for our clients.

What you’ll do:

  • Work closely with the operation and non‑operation and Kraken Technologies teams to define the product vision and strategy.
  • Identify new ideas and technology to improve the product.
  • Define the MVP and test‑&‑learn approach for the product capability.
  • Support the business with issue resolution for the product.
  • Support the engineering teams to deliver product features.
  • Manage the relationship with client counterparts, being the first point of contact for tech development and issue resolution.
  • Triage incoming requests and communicate client priorities to the right domains in the development team.
  • Ensure we are constantly reviewing and adapting to customer and business needs.

What you’ll have:

  • Degree‑qualified equivalent, with strong client delivery and/or product ownership experience.
  • Experience working within the financial industry.
  • Strong agile delivery experience and product management skills.
  • Experience with product management and customer journeys.
  • Solid understanding of technology and associated trends.
  • Excellent communication, collaboration, and presentation skills.
  • Strong influencing skills and ability to challenge traditional ways of thinking.
  • Experience working with significant complex delivery pipelines for clients.
  • Patience – our clients are undergoing huge transformations that take time and require our understanding.
  • Laser focus on clients, relentless problem solving, invincible attitude, a winner!
  • Consulting experience is a plus.
